Output 95b669ea8ad3ab22ecbb3ec5e70cd7e4b6be344b1567f7a3d28b31ecac7900b3:109

value
1655012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3797e7ac87e44f518689c55e0575af3da39c4e58 OP_EQUAL
address
DAD3gMN4J8Yj3G8e2QwTRCfncW1TtQjaRc
transaction
95b669ea8ad3ab22ecbb3ec5e70cd7e4b6be344b1567f7a3d28b31ecac7900b3
spent
true